Transaction 024ff81f07ab31c9a6808ffd836453d966ffb26b0973ee08689db37b4e1e9618

3 Input
2 Outputs
  • 024ff81f07ab31c9a6808ffd836453d966ffb26b0973ee08689db37b4e1e9618:0
  • value  143902
    address  1KYW8TuVBvg5ku86Ncdtg8uHegfcQstaSH
  • 024ff81f07ab31c9a6808ffd836453d966ffb26b0973ee08689db37b4e1e9618:1
  • value  166874
    address  3BMEX5Uw9zZYs9DyhkMhD2mknccoPb8NcN